Class ImageProcessing
Název místa: Aspose.OCR Sbírka: Aspose.OCR.dll (25.4.0)
Pomocná třída pro ASPOSE OCR knihovnu. umožňuje předběžné zpracování a ukládání obrázk.
public static class ImageProcessing
Inheritance
Dědiční členové
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Methods
Render(OcrInput)
Použijte zpracování obrazu pro zlepšení přesnosti OCR.Vytvořte seznam filtrů, které budou aplikovány na vstupní obrázek v pořadí, které specifikujete.Příkladem je vytvoření filtru:Předprocesní filtry = nové předprocesní filtry{PřepracováníFilter.Invert(),předběžné zpracováníFilter.Threshold(150),PřepracováníFilter.Binarize(),Předběžné zpracováníFilter.Rotate(180),Předběžné zpracováníFilter.Resize(3000,3000, Aspose.OCR.Filters.InterpolationFilterType.Box),Předběžné zpracováníFilter.Scale(6f),PřepracováníFilter.Dilate()};a to};Nepotřebujete je všechny. nastavte jen to, co potřebujete.
public static OcrInput Render(OcrInput images)
Parameters
images
OcrInput
Objekt OcrInput obsahující různé obrázky Aspose.OCR.OcrInput.
Returns
Objekt OcrInput obsahující výsledky zpracované obrázky v tokovém poli.Aspose.OCR.OcrInput.
Save(Zpět na String)
Použijte zpracování obrazu pro zlepšení přesnosti OCR.Vytvořte seznam filtrů, které budou aplikovány na vstupní obrázek v pořadí, které specifikujete.Příklad vytvoření filtru:Předprocesní filtry = nové předprocesní filtry{PřepracováníFilter.Invert(),předběžné zpracováníFilter.Threshold(150),PřepracováníFilter.Binarize(),Předběžné zpracováníFilter.Rotate(180),Předběžné zpracováníFilter.Resize(3000,3000, Aspose.OCR.Filters.InterpolationFilterType.Box),Předběžné zpracováníFilter.Scale(6f),PřepracováníFilter.Dilate()};a to};Nepotřebujete je všechny. nastavte jen to, co potřebujete.
public static OcrInput Save(OcrInput images, string folderPath)
Parameters
images
OcrInput
Objekt OcrInput obsahující různé obrázky Aspose.OCR.OcrInput.
folderPath
string
Cesta bez názvů obrázků pro zachování zpracovaných obrázk.
Returns
Objekt OcrInput obsahující výsledky zpracované obrázky Aspose.OCR.OcrInput.